A three bedroom bungalow and annexe between Stock and Billericay.

Description

The property is situated in a quiet backwater within an attractive tree-lined lane to the south of the village of Stock. Despite the rural situation, there are shops, railway stations and golf and country clubs close by. There is a network of footpaths and bridleways immediately in the area.

The accommodation is versatile, and all the rooms overlook the gardens, which enjoy a great deal of privacy. To the front, the lounge has a red-brick fireplace with log burner complemented by ceiling trusses and a wooden floor. Adjacent is a separate sitting room (or bedroom four). There are three bedrooms, two overlooking the rear gardens, a family bathroom and a cloakroom. On the opposite side of the bungalow is the kitchen/breakfast room, finished with a country feel utilising Shaker-style units with contrasting stone tops and an inset butler sink, ceiling trusses and a wooden floor. There is an AGA , an electric hob, an integrated dishwasher and space for a breakfast table. A stable-style door opens onto a covered terrace. Adjacent to the kitchen is a fitted utility room and useful pantry.

Annexe
Next to the bungalow is a detached annexe comprising a lounge/bedroom, a kitchen and a shower room.

Outside
A drive off the lane is finished in gravel providing parking behind a five-bar gate. A pathway next to the drive leads to the bungalow and gardens. The front garden is generous in size, predominantly lawn and enclosed by high hedging. There is access around the property to the rear gardens. Designed for al fresco dining and entertaining, there is a covered patio behind the bungalow with a large terrace separating the bungalow from the annexe. The gardens are laid to lawn, dissected by a central pathway which leads to a garden cabin and fishpond. The cabin is used to work from home with power and light.

Location

Stock village: 1.7 miles, Billericay and railway station: 2.9 miles, A12 (J16): 3.2 miles, Chelmsford City: 6.7 miles. All distances approximate.

The property is situated in a quiet backwater within an attractive tree-lined lane to the south of the village of Stock.

Stock provides good amenities including a C of E primary school, a village hall with pre-school, four public houses/eateries, a library, a post office and general store. The village is surrounded by some of the most attractive countryside in south Essex, with miles of cycle ways, footpaths and bridleways.

Chelmsford city (under 8 miles to the north) has a pedestrianised shopping area including the Bond Street shopping area with bespoke shops, restaurants and John Lewis. Chelmsford also has some highly rated schools including two grammar schools, three private prep schools and a railway station on the main line into Liverpool Street.

To the south, Billericay lies some three miles away with a good selection of shops including Waitrose supermarket, a selection of state and private schooling and a mainline station to Shenfield with Crossrail service.

    Broadband availability and predicted speed

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ile phone signal availability and predicted strength

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
